Dombey en Zoon, written by Charles Dickens and published in 1846, follows the story of Mr. Dombey, a proud businessman who desires to have his son succeed him in his trading firm. Throughout the narrative, Dombey loses his son, wealth, and both of his wives, ultimately leading him to a profound realization about the true values in life. The novel explores themes of pride and women's emancipation, making it a significant work in Dickens' oeuvre.
